Browsing the Features Landscape: What to Look for in a Robot Hoover

Picking the ideal robot hoover includes considering numerous key functions to guarantee it satisfies your particular requirements and home environment. Here's a breakdown of important aspects to evaluate:

  1. Navigation System: This is the “brain” of the robot hoover.

    • Random Bounce Navigation: Basic designs utilize this system, bouncing arbitrarily around the room till they cover the area. They are less effective and might miss areas.
    • Methodical Navigation (Line-by-Line or Room-by-Room): More sophisticated models utilize sensors and mapping innovation (like gyroscopes, cams, or LiDAR) to clean up in a structured pattern. This is much more effective and ensures extensive protection.
    • Mapping and Room Recognition: Premium designs create a map of your home, permitting zoned cleaning, virtual borders, and room-specific cleaning schedules. This is perfect for larger homes or those with specific cleaning needs for various spaces.
  2. Suction Power and Cleaning Performance: Suction power identifies how efficiently the robot hoover chooses up dirt and debris.

    • Consider floor types: Homes with carpets require greater suction power than those with mainly difficult floorings.
    • Pet Hair Specific Models: Look for models particularly created for pet hair, often including more powerful suction and specialized brush rolls.
  3. Battery Life and Charging: Battery life dictates the period of a cleaning cycle.

    • Consider your home size: Larger homes require longer battery life.
    • Auto-Recharge and Resume: Many designs automatically go back to their charging dock when the battery is low and can resume cleaning where they left off. This is an important function for bigger homes or longer cleaning cycles.
  4. Dustbin Capacity and Emptying: The dustbin size identifies how frequently you require to clear it.

    • Bigger dustbins require less frequent emptying.
    • Self-Emptying Docks: Some high-end designs include self-emptying docks that instantly empty the robot's dustbin into a larger container, further minimizing maintenance frequency.
  5. Brush System: The brush system is crucial for reliable particles removal.

    • Main Brush Roll: Look for a mix brush roll (bristles and rubber fins) for effective cleaning on both carpets and tough floorings.
    • Side Brushes: Side brushes help sweep debris from edges and corners into the path of the main brush.
  6. Filtering System: The filtration system catches dust and allergens.

    • HEPA Filters: Essential for allergy victims, HEPA filters trap fine dust particles and irritants, enhancing air quality.
  7. Smart Features and App Control: Modern robot hoovers frequently feature smart functions and app control.

    • Scheduling: Set cleaning schedules for particular times and days.
    • Zone Cleaning: Define particular areas to tidy or prevent.
    • Virtual Boundaries: Create unnoticeable walls to avoid the robot from going into specific locations.
    • Voice Control Integration: Some designs incorporate with voice assistants like Amazon Alexa or Google Assistant.
  8. Obstacle Avoidance and Cliff Sensors:

    • Obstacle Avoidance: Advanced sensing units help robots navigate around furnishings and obstacles successfully, lessening bumping and getting stuck.
    • Cliff Sensors: Prevent the robot from dropping stairs or edges.
  9. Noise Level: Robot hoovers vary in sound level. Think about designs with quieter operation if sound sensitivity is a concern.
